Building the Business Case for Predictive Analytics: Nucleus Research by SPSS Inc. Worldwide Headquarters
February 20, 2009 - (Free Research)
Predictive analytics encompasses a variety of techniques from statistics and data mining that analyze current and historical data to make predictions about future events. In this Nucleus Research report, learn how your company can achieve ROI from Predictive analytics applications.

Best Practices in the Call Center: A Customer Touch-Point Methodology by Oracle Corporation
January 26, 2009 - (Free Research)
One of the biggest dangers in establishing best practices for your contact center is to do so in isolation from your self-service stakeholders. Instead, all customer "touch-points" must be viewed as part of a continuum. Customer touch points include Web Self-Service, Interactive Voice Response, Contact Center Agents, and Face-to-Face transactions.
